当前位置:网站首页 > 数码新品 > 正文

数据库覆盖恢复技巧与方法(如何从数据库被覆盖中成功恢复数据)

游客游客 2025-08-02 19:38 130

在日常工作和生活中,数据库扮演着重要的角色,存储和管理着大量的数据。然而,由于各种原因,如误操作、硬件故障或恶意攻击,数据库可能会被覆盖,导致数据丢失。本文将介绍一些常见的数据库覆盖恢复技巧和方法,帮助用户从数据库覆盖中成功恢复数据。

备份与还原

1.生成数据库备份

通过使用数据库管理系统提供的备份功能,生成数据库的定期备份。这样,在数据库被覆盖后,可以通过还原备份来恢复数据。

2.还原数据库备份

在数据库被覆盖后,通过使用备份文件的还原功能,将备份文件中的数据还原到原始数据库中。

日志恢复

3.了解数据库日志

数据库通常会记录每个事务的操作日志,包括对数据的增删改操作。通过了解日志的格式和内容,可以更好地进行日志恢复。

4.应用事务日志

通过使用数据库管理系统提供的日志恢复功能,将日志文件应用到数据库中,以恢复被覆盖的数据。

数据库镜像

5.创建数据库镜像

通过数据库管理系统提供的数据库镜像功能,可以实时将原始数据库的副本保持在另一个位置。当原始数据库被覆盖后,可以使用数据库镜像中的数据进行恢复。

6.切换到数据库镜像

在数据库被覆盖后,将应用程序或用户的操作切换到数据库镜像,以确保数据的连续性,并避免进一步的数据丢失。

专业恢复软件

7.恢复软件选择

选择可靠的数据库恢复软件,根据被覆盖的数据库类型和具体情况进行恢复操作。

8.使用恢复软件

根据软件的使用说明,按照指引操作恢复软件,以尝试从被覆盖的数据库中恢复数据。

寻求专业帮助

9.联系数据库厂商支持

当面临无法解决的数据库覆盖问题时,联系数据库厂商的技术支持团队,寻求他们的帮助和建议。

10.请数据库专业人士协助

如果数据库覆盖恢复的问题非常复杂或紧急,可以请专业的数据库管理员或数据恢复专家来协助解决问题。

数据恢复成功与预防措施

11.成功恢复被覆盖的数据

通过上述的恢复技巧和方法,成功从数据库覆盖中恢复丢失的数据。

12.数据库备份策略优化

重新评估和优化数据库备份策略,确保定期备份的完整性和可用性,以减少数据丢失风险。

13.强化权限管理与审计

加强数据库的权限管理措施,限制对数据库的访问权限,定期审计数据库操作,防止误操作和恶意攻击。

14.数据库容灾与高可用性

考虑使用数据库容灾技术和高可用性方案,以确保在数据库覆盖等灾难事件中,数据可以快速且可靠地恢复。

15.数据库监控与预警

使用数据库监控工具,及时发现数据库异常或故障,提前采取措施,减少因覆盖导致的数据丢失。

数据库覆盖可能导致重要数据的丢失,但通过备份与还原、日志恢复、数据库镜像、专业恢复软件、寻求专业帮助等一系列技巧和方法,可以成功地从数据库覆盖中恢复数据。此外,优化备份策略、强化权限管理与审计、数据库容灾与高可用性、数据库监控与预警等措施也是预防数据库覆盖的重要手段。只有不断加强对数据库安全的重视和保护,才能最大程度地减少数据丢失的风险。

转载请注明来自科技前沿网,本文标题:《数据库覆盖恢复技巧与方法(如何从数据库被覆盖中成功恢复数据)》

标签:

网站分类
网站分类
最近发表
标签列表
友情链接